Obituary: James Parrinello, 38, of Sterling Heights.  James Michael Parrinello, 38, passed away on Sunday, Jan. 17, 2021. He was born May 7, 1982, the son of James and Michele Parrinello, of Scottville. James was a 2000 graduate of Mason County Central and a United States Navy veteran, Golden Gloves Boxing champion, and a dedicated artist who enjoyed helping others.…

Initiative encourages students to complete financial aid apps. February launches a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A) frenzy across the county, when high school seniors complete their FAFSA application before the state March 1 deadline for Michigan Competitive Scholarship. Mason County high schools are participating in an initiative, which seniors can win prizes by completing the Free Application for…
